2011 SUMMERVILLE PARADE ENTRY WINNERS

Friday afternoon, Summerville DREAM and the Summerville Fire Dept. had the opportunity to present plaques to two of the four groups of winners for the 2011 Annual Summerville Christmas Parade at the Summerville Fire Station. ServiceMaster of Charleston which won for the Award for Best Adherence to the “DREAMing of a GREEN Christmas” theme received their plaque from Susan Morris, executive director of Summerville DREAM and Chief Rodney Profit of the SFD. Accepting the award were Chantell Green, Elizabeth Thomas and Brian Hines.

Rose Court Farms accepted the award for the Most Creative entry and they were represented by Sue Callahan, Kathy Stell, Faith and Steve Williams, Robert Browning, Christina & Luke Clark, Taylor Young, Madi and Mary Cutts and Sadey, the dog.

The two Cub Scout Packs that were award winners were unable to be at the fire Station for the plaque presentation, however they sent pictures of the scouts who participated. Cub Scout Pack 776 sent a picture taken the day of the parade with their float which won the award for the Most Original entry. Cub Scout Pack 759 won the award for the Best Overall Entry in the 2011 parade and sent a picture of their scouts at their recent Pinewood Derby.

“We would like to extend our congratulations to all the entry winners for a job well done as well as thanks to all the entries that joined us in creating another wonderful Summerville Christmas Parade!” Morris said.
